Just as its nickname, 'cream city', has nothing to do with beer or dairy, the city of Milwaukee itself is fraught with surprises. While it is undoubtedly the jovial land of beer and cheese (and brats, bowling and The Brewers, for that matter) the city is also a center for world-class art, architecture, culture and innovation, and has been since the 1800s.

Discover Milwaukee's most unexpected treasures - visit a 15th century French chapel, or a 425 million-year-old tropical reef. Throw a turkey at the nation's oldest sanctioned bowling alley. Watch an art museum flap its wings or tour the city's only urban cheese factory to find out why cheese curds squeak.

Milwaukee, a city both stunning and charming, also possesses a dry, self-deprecating wit and goofy cleverness. Visit 111 amazing places that reveal this unique character, one that keeps Milwaukee's locals local, and beckons visitors back again and again.
